The Short Version
- •Rent is 68% cheaper in Taipei ($735/mo vs $2288/mo for a 1BR city centre).
- •Summers are dramatically warmer in Dubai (41°C vs 32°C).
- •Taipei scores higher on democracy (8.9 vs 3.1 / 10 EIU).

Is Dubai cheaper than Taipei?▾
Taipei is cheaper. A 1-bedroom apartment in city centre costs around $735/month in Taipei vs $2288/month in the other city (Numbeo data).
Which is safer, Dubai or Taipei?▾
Taipei is statistically safer based on UNODC homicide data. Dubai has a rate of 0.75 per 100,000 and Taipei has 0.60 per 100,000.

Is it easier to get residency in Dubai or Taipei?▾
Dubai: UAE Remote Work Visa (moderate requirements, 1 year (renewable)). Taipei: Taiwan Gold Card (easy to get, 1–3 years (open work permit)). See each city's profile page for full requirements.
